
Morning Microdose
Morning Microdose is a daily podcast that offers short, powerful excerpts from the Almost 30 Podcast, hosted by Krista Williams and Lindsey Simcik. Each episode is designed to prime your mind, body, and soul for a beautiful day ahead in less than ten minutes. The podcast focuses on intentional morning routines, featuring thought-provoking conversations and insights to set a positive tone for the day. It aims to help listeners wake up both literally and spiritually, curating content that inspires and uplifts.
